Method
Crust Preparation
- 1
Make the crust
In a large bowl, combine the all-purpose flour and salt. Cut in the unsalted butter until the mixture resembles coarse crumbs. Stir in the cold water, a tablespoon at a time, until the dough comes together. Form into a disk, wrap in plastic wrap, and refrigerate for at least 30 minutes.
- 2
Roll out the dough
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C). On a floured surface, roll out the chilled dough to fit a 9-inch tart pan. Press the dough into the pan and trim any excess. Prick the bottom with a fork and line with parchment paper. Fill with pie weights or dried beans.
- 3
Bake the crust
Bake the crust in the preheated oven for 15 minutes. Remove the weights and parchment paper, and bake for an additional 10 minutes until golden brown. Set aside to cool.
Filling Preparation
- 4
Prepare the filling
In a mixing bowl, combine the goat cheese, heavy cream, eggs, thyme, chives, salt, and black pepper. Whisk until smooth and well combined.
- 5
Fill the crust
Pour the goat cheese mixture into the cooled tart crust, spreading it evenly. Bake in the oven at 375°F (190°C) for 25-30 minutes until the filling is set and slightly puffed.
Pomegranate Gastrique Preparation
- 6
Make the gastrique
In a saucepan over medium heat, combine the pomegranate juice, sugar, and red wine vinegar. Bring to a simmer and cook for 15-20 minutes, stirring occasionally, until the mixture thickens and coats the back of a spoon. Set aside to cool.
Salad Preparation
- 7
Prepare the salad
In a large bowl, toss the chopped endives and herbs with olive oil, salt, and black pepper to taste. Set aside.
Assembly
- 8
Assemble the tart
Once the tart has cooled slightly, slice it into wedges and serve topped with the endive salad and drizzled with pomegranate gastrique.
